Article: Top 10 Korean Celebrities Who Became Major Brand Ambassadors In 2022

People born in the 70s or 80 saw that all significant fashion houses were endorsed only by Hollywood celebrities, but times are changing, and so are the trends. South Korea has created a noticeable cultural wave internationally since the 1990s, popularly known as the Hallyu wave or the K wave. With their global reach, South Korean celebrities have garnered love and adoration from audiences across different geographical boundaries so it was only natural for major fashion houses to have them as their brand ambassadors. Let us look at some of these major power-packed collaborations.

1. Zico 

Zico debuted as a K-pop artist in 2011 and in a short period, Zico has become a household name in Korea as a singer, rapper, and songwriter. As soon as Zico completed his mandatory military training this year, he shook hands with the iconic brand FENDI as their brand ambassador. In the initial campaign, the hip-hopper is sporting an overall white denim look from the brand’s Menswear Collection and contrasting it with black Peekaboo and Baguette, a signature collection from FENDI.

 

2. Jisoo

On 24th May, luxury jewelry and watches brand Cartier announced Jisoo as their global brand ambassador. Jisoo is a famous K-pop singer and member of the popular BlackPink group. This collaboration is another feather in the singer’s cap as she already has a long association with Dior. Jisoo’s elegance and style resonate with Cartier’s distinctiveness and elegance. Jisoo shared her excitement to be a part of Panthere de Cartier on her Instagram handle.

 

3. Yoon Chan -Young

Netflix’s hit thriller series All of Us are Dead is quite a rage worldwide. Along with the k-drama’s success, another Korean talent Yoon Chan -young rose to stardom. Yoon Chan has become a household name in South Korea. Global brand Coach grabbed this opportunity and struck a deal with the 21-year-old star as their first brand ambassador for South Korea.  The brand’s first marketing campaign shows Chan donning their Spring 2022 ready-to-wear collection.

5. Lisa

BlackPink’s Lisa is a global celebrity and a trendsetter, known for her bold and confident demeanor. Chivas, a well-known Scotch brand partnered with the rapper this year, making Lisa the brand’s first female face in Asia. Lisa is also associated with Bvlgari since 2020. In a recent ad campaign, Lisa was seen along with the brand’s other global ambassadors like Zendaya, Lily Aldridge, Vittoria Ceretti, and Priyanka Chopra Jonas. Apart from this, Lisa endorses cosmetic giant MAC and also Celine.

 

6. Rose

South Korean K-pop sensation Rose, became the brand ambassador of Tiffany & Co in 2021. She featured in the brand’s latest campaign for its hardware range. Tiffany & Co is a New York-based global high-end jewelry company. Rose personifies the brand’s exclusivity and creativity with fine craftsmanship. In February this year, Rose also bagged another deal with South Korea’s discounted retail store Homeplus. The retail brand launched a special marketing campaign this year to mark its silver jubilee celebration. Rose’s presence in the campaign increased the brand’s popularity significantly and gave the brand a feel of a luxury brand.

 

7. Kim Soo-Hyun

Kim Soo -Hyun is one of the highest-paid actors in South Korea. Kim made it to the list of Forbes Top Forty Korean Power Celebrities. Kim is known as ‘the king of product endorsements’ in South Korea. He has endorsed numerous local brands, and in September 2021, Kim was appointed by the brand as their global ambassador. In June this year, Kim cracked another deal with Y.O.U. Beauty as their latest brand ambassador.

 

8. Jung Ho Yeon

Jung Ho Yeon is a model turned actress and is a name to reckon with in the fashion world. Jung began her career when she walked the ramp in Seoul Fashion Week and gained significant attention. Jung cat walked for numerous luxury brands in New York Fashion Week and Paris Fashion Week. Jung Ho reinvented herself and took to acting in the breakthrough series Squid Game. This series has made her a global star. The French luxury fashion house Louis Vuitton appointed the star as their global ambassador for fashion, watches, and jewelry.
